Illamasqua Gradient Stamped Houndstooth Mani

In this mani I used Illamasqua Muse as the base, stamped with a gradient houndstooth.  I love how this looks on the nail, and will definitely be experimenting with it more in the future!  The black and white used are Wet N Wild Black Creme and Sinful Colors Snow Me White. Plate used was Cheeky CH13 with the variation of a houndstooth.

To get a gradient to use as the stamped image instead of the base image, you add 2 colors to the stamping plate on opposite ends letting the two colors touch in the middle.  From there you take you old gift card and scrape directly across where the two colors meet, in order to mix the two colors in the middle without moving one color to the opposite side and to spread the color evenly across the image plate. where the two colors meet is where the color has mixed, and in this case, Black and white create grey in the middle. Review Matte-n-a Mystery

I found this polish in a local Beauty Supply in an almost full display.  The Polish is Mystery From Makeup Cherimoya  and the line is Matte-n-a-.  As the name suggests the whole line of these polishes are matte.

First I would like to say that these polishes stink to high heaven.  The smell is worse than Kleancolor, It is so strong and just smells like it's not 3-free.  For some reason I can not access the Cherimoya site to see if they are or not, so for right now I will assume they are not.

In the bottle Mystery has me sooo intrigued.  Then when I polished my nails with it, it really was a mystery.  I liked the polish before it turned matte.

Here is the polish Matte on my nails:

 I thought it was a really pretty and the shiny-ness of it made me think it would be great for stamping, so I also stamped it on my one nail to see how it would do.  It stamped well, but I had to work fast, because the matte pigments make it dry super fast, so I had to move quickly. (I used Cheeky Plate CH5)

 Then I wanted to add a top coat to see the amazing shiny-ness that amazed me at first, and I was not dissappointed.  I think that these polishes should stay shiny instead of matte, because it's so much prettier in my opinion. 

Also, the Seche Vite I used was old, and smeared the stamp, which was a disappointment, but I didn't have enough on my brush and my brush swiped against the stamp, so that was mainly user error.

Here is a bottle shot if you are interested:

Final Thoughts: I don't think I will be purchasing any more of these, they just stink too much for me, and at $2.99 I don't want to pay for something that stinks that bad.  I am also not a fan of the already matte polishes, because I have a matte top coat, so i feel like I could add the matte if I wanted it to be mattte, but that is just me.  And I think that these polishes are so much prettier before they are matte.
